Designing the Focal Point: Material and Style Selection
The foundation of any successful built in fake fireplace lies in the selection of materials that mimic the authenticity of natural stone or brick. Homeowners can choose between high-density fiberboard (HDF) finished with realistic veneers, ceramic tile for a customizable surface, or prefabricated metal units that slot neatly into a framed surround. The style dictates the room’s personality: a rustic fieldstone veneer evokes mountain lodges, while sleek marble slabs convey modern minimalism. It is crucial to consider the scale relative to the wall space; a mantel that is too small can look amateurish, whereas an oversized structure can overwhelm a modest room. Integrating the design with existing architecture—such as matching ceiling height or flooring tones—ensures the installation feels bespoke rather than bolted on.
Mechanical Realism: The Technology Behind the Illusion
Advances in electric and gas technology have revolutionized the realism of built in fake fireplace effects. Electric units utilize sophisticated LED arrays and dual-flame technology to replicate the flicker of genuine embers, often paired with ultra-quart fans that circulate warm air to create a genuine heat output of up to 5,000 BTUs. For those who prefer the scent and crackle of wood, ethanol insert fireplaces offer a vent-free solution, producing a real flame with minimal soot and no need for a chimney. When planning the installation, it is essential to consider the electrical load; high-output models may require a dedicated circuit, while lower-voltage units can often tap into existing outlets, making the retrofit process significantly smoother.

Layout and Spatial Integration
Positioning a built in fake fireplace requires a strategic approach to ensure it enhances the room’s flow rather than disrupting it. In living rooms, the unit should align with the primary seating area, ideally centered on the wall to create a symmetrical anchor. In open-concept spaces, the fireplace can serve as a subtle divider, defining the living zone without closing off the kitchen or dining area. For optimal impact, the mantel shelf should be installed at a height that aligns with the sightlines of viewers seated in their favorite chairs. This often places the mantel at eye level when seated, maximizing the decorative impact of the artwork or decor placed above.
Functional Advantages and Efficiency
Beyond aesthetics, a built in fake fireplace offers distinct functional advantages that appeal to the practical homeowner. Unlike traditional wood fires, these units require no chopping, hauling, or storage of firewood, eliminating the mess tracked through the home. They are also far safer, with cool-to-touch glass fronts and no exposed flames, making them ideal for households with children or pets. Furthermore, the efficiency of electric units means nearly all the energy consumed is converted into ambient heat, reducing energy waste. This combination of safety, cleanliness, and efficiency makes these installations particularly attractive for urban apartments or regions where wood-burning restrictions are common.
Customization and Mantel Design
The true beauty of a built in fake fireplace is the level of personalization available through the mantel design. Homeowners are not confined to the standard rectangular slab; options include arched headers for a French provincial feel, minimal floating shelves for a contemporary edge, or reclaimed timber for a rustic touch. The mantel provides a platform for curated collections, such as stacked art books, sculptural ceramics, or framed vintage mirrors. To achieve a cohesive look, it is wise to plan the mantel decor during the initial design phase. This ensures the depth and scale of the shelf complement the size of the firebox, preventing the space from feeling cluttered or unbalanced once the installation is complete.
